Frequently Asked Questions about Worcester
How much are Studio apartments in Worcester?
There are currently 303 Studio Apartments in Worcester with rent ranges from $1,200 to $2,570 with an average price of $1,827.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Worcester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Worcester ranges from $958 to $4,248 with an average monthly rent of $2,220.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Worcester c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Worcester range from $1,300 to $5,200.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,736.
How expensive are Worcester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 174 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Worcester on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$750 to $8,235 - averaging $2,641 for the location.
